The catalytic hydrolysis of soybean oil was used as an alternative for the production of monoglycerides (MG) and diglycerides (DG). The reactions were conducted in a stainless-steel tubular reactor in the temperature range of 240–290 °C, on niobium phosphate (NBP) and niobium oxide (NBO) as catalysts. In the hydrolysis reactions at 270 °C, the maximum selectivities of the products of interest were obtained at 22 % MG and 48 % DG for the reaction with NBP, and 7 % MG and 33 % DG with NBO, for 59 % and 36 % of triglyceride conversion in 10 min, respectively. The proposed kinetic model presented a good fit of the theoretical model with the experimental data, showing that the previous hypotheses considered for the mechanism development are suitable for describing the kinetics of soybean oil hydrolysis. 相似文献

ABSTRACT The treatment of animals with antimicrobial products may lead to the contamination of edible tissues by their residues, which may represent a risk to human health. Therefore, this study aimed to determine the level of antimicrobial residues in food-producing animals (chicken, beef, and milk) in Lebanon. A total of 310 samples were collected and analysed using an LC-MS/MS for the determination of 48 compounds belonging to different families in order to map their compliance according to the European Commission decision 2002/657/EC. Results show that 60% of the analysed samples were not contaminated by any residue, while 12% presented a concentration higher than the MRLs for tetracyclines, sulphonamides, quinolones, and macrolides. Results revealed that chicken were the most contaminated by antimicrobial residues, when compared to beef and milk. The obtained results demonstrate the uncontrolled use of antimicrobials in some Lebanese farms and claim for better management of livestock. 相似文献

In this work, we report the fabrication of ordered silicon structures by chemical etching of silicon in vanadium oxide (V2O5)/hydrofluoric acid (HF) solution. The effects of the different etching parameters including the solution concentration, temperature, and the presence of metal catalyst film deposition (Pd) on the morphologies and reflective properties of the etched Si surfaces were studied. Scanning electron microscopy (SEM) was carried out to explore the morphologies of the etched surfaces with and without the presence of catalyst. In this case, the attack on the surfaces with a palladium deposit begins by creating uniform circular pores on silicon in which we distinguish the formation of pyramidal structures of silicon. Fourier transform infrared spectroscopy (FTIR) demonstrates that the surfaces are H-terminated. A UV-Vis-NIR spectrophotometer was used to study the reflectance of the structures obtained. A reflectance of 2.21% from the etched Si surfaces in the wavelength range of 400 to 1,000 nm was obtained after 120 min of etching while it is of 4.33% from the Pd/Si surfaces etched for 15 min. 相似文献

Morphological characterization was investigated by agro-morphological criteria related to carob seed size in four different moroccan regions collected in 2018 and 2019. There was no significant difference (p ≤ 0.05) on the seeds lengths and widths. However, a significant difference between seeds thickness and total seeds weight per pod (p ≤ 0.05) were observed between these four populations. The fatty acid, sterol, tocopherol, hydrocarbon, and the unoxygenated composition of carob seed extracts (Ceratonia siliqua L.) were studied. The mean fat yield of the seeds obtained is 1.53%–2.17%, 2.14%–2.15%, 1.61%–1.62%, 1.71%–1.75% for, respectively, the P1 (Meknes), P2 (Fez), P3 (Khemisset), and P4 (Marrakech) in 2018 and 2019. The seed oil was extracted with hexane and the analysis of the fatty fraction was performed by gas chromatography–mass spectrometry (GC–MS). Results show that the major fatty acids for 2018 and 2019 are linoleic acid (61.48%–61.52%, 52.12%–52.14%, 57.76%–58.15%, 61.33%–61.52%), palmitic acid (15.78%–15.81%, 16.44%–16.45%, 19.11%–18.37%, 20.24%–20.32%), oleic acid (11.03%–11.04%, 8.72%–8.82%, 8.51%–8.61%, 8.41%–8.53%), stearic acid (4.35%–3.14%, 5.40%–5.43%, 3.12%–3.13%, 0.96%–1.56%), and cerotic acid (0.62%–0.53%, 4.51%–4.52%, 4.03%–4.06%, 3.84%–3.87%). The unsaturated fatty acids (69.39% in 2018 and 69.68% in 2019) are the most dominant in the four seed extracts compared to the saturated fatty acids. In addition, the oil carob seeds analysis revealed the presence of γ-tocopherol, α-tocopherol and four sterols that included campesterol, stigmasterol, and β-sitosterol. Moreover, the determination of hydrocarbon and un-oxygenated compounds confirmed the existence of major compounds such as heptadecane, 2-methyltriacontane, 1-iodo hexadecane and 1-iodo octadecane. The hierarchical analysis based on the morphological and chromatographic characterization of the seeds allowed the identification of three groups. Consequently, the first group consisted of populations from Marrakesh (P4) and Khemisset (P3), the second group consisted of the P1 from Meknes, and the P2 from Fez constituted the third group. 相似文献

This paper reports a discrimination study based on the physico‐chemical characteristics, fatty acids and profile of volatile compounds of the seeds from seven date palm varieties (Phoenix dactylifera L.) grown in Tunisia. Date seeds contained 10.49–14.76% moisture; 6.28–11.2% fat (on a dry weight basis); 2.67–12.85% protein; 0.91–6.06% reducing sugar; 0.61–2.98% sucrose and 0.97–1.17% ash. Gas liquid chromatography revealed that the oil fraction of the date palm seeds contained eighteen fatty acids, with oleic acid (30.77–42.50%) and lauric acid (18.51–27.48%) as the main unsaturated and saturated ones. Volatile profile showed differences among varieties. In total, forty‐five compounds were identified, mainly alcohols, aldehydes and unsaturated hydrocarbons ones. This study provides evidence that the seeds of date may be a potential source of valuable nutrients with interesting functionality. 相似文献

Brown tumors (BTs) are relatively uncommon but they are serious complications of renal osteodystrophy. The objective of this study was to analyze the clinical, biological, and radiological characteristics of 16 patients with BTs provoked by secondary hyperparathyroidism (sHPT) and its response to the decrease in parathyroid hormone levels after parathyroidectomy (PTX). The management of that uncommon condition was also reviewed. We conducted a retrospective study including 16 end‐stage renal disease patients who underwent subtotal PTX between 1997 and 2007 for severe sHPT with BTs. Our study included 10 men and 6 women, whose average age was 34 years. All patients were on dialysis. Ten of them were on dialysis for more than 5 years. The median duration on dialysis was 84 months. Patients included suffered from swellings associated with functional limitations. BTs had multiple locations in 7 patients. Jaw was the most frequent location (62%). Radiography and tomodensitometry demonstrated a mixed radio lucent and radio‐opaque lesions with an expansion of the cortical bone. Bone scan demonstrated an increased uptake of lesions. Chirurgical treatment was indicated in all cases because of severe refractory sHPT with functional limitations and/or disfiguring deformities. In all cases, BTs stopped its progression and even decreased in size. However, it was insufficient in four cases, which required a surgical resection. PTX remains an efficacious approach in resistant cases of sHPT with persistent BTs. 相似文献
